Acorns continues as Warriors’ Charity Partner

Acorns Children’s Hospice will continue as Warriors’ Charity Partner for the 2016/17 season.

The relationship has developed over a number of seasons and peaked during the 2015/16 season when over £25,000 was raised by the Club’s partners and fans. 

This season will be no different as Warriors’ Main Club Sponsor, Greene King IPA, has agreed that the Acorns logo can be placed on the front of all children’s replica shirts – giving the charity an increased brand presence throughout the Midlands.

Director of Income Generation for Acorns Louise Arnold said: “We are delighted to feature on the front of the Warriors children’s shirts. 

“The relationship between Warriors and Acorns continues to go from strength to strength and this gesture underlines the Club’s commitment to supporting us as Charity Partner.

“We’re really excited about the 2016/17 season and we are looking forward to some fantastic fundraising events. 

“We rely on the community to help fund our work so the Warriors partnership is one we’re extremely grateful for.”

Warriors player and Acorns Ambassador Sam Betty added: “Acorns is part of the fabric of the Club.

“The squad and staff are aware of the excellent work the charity carries out within the area and are proud to assist with fundraising efforts. 

“Last year was a record year so we would be delighted if we can top that this season.”

This season’s Acorns Charity Matchday will take place on Sunday 1 January 2017 when Warriors come up against Harlequins at Sixways.
